* WHAT...Minor flooding is forecast.
* WHERE...Grand River near Brunswick.
* WHEN...From this afternoon to Sunday afternoon.
*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...
- At 6:34 AM CDT Tuesday the stage was 17.6 feet.
- Forecast...The river is expected to rise above flood stage late
this afternoon to a crest of 25.6 feet early Friday morning. It
will then fall below flood stage Saturday afternoon.
- Flood stage is 19.0 feet.

Turn around, don't dr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ood
deaths occur in vehicles.
Motorists should not attempt to drive around barricades or drive cars
through flooded areas.
